Skip to content

Commit

Permalink
[project/vc] update for mbedtls
Browse files Browse the repository at this point in the history
  • Loading branch information
versaloon committed Sep 7, 2023
1 parent 0b7c875 commit c601313
Show file tree
Hide file tree
Showing 2 changed files with 72 additions and 0 deletions.
18 changes: 18 additions & 0 deletions example/template/project/vc/vsf_template_win.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,17 @@
</ProjectConfiguration>
</ItemGroup>
<ItemGroup>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time_internal.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time_invasive.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\ecp_invasive.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_common.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_error.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_reader.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_trace.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_aead.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_cipher.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_hash.h" />
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_mac.h" />
<ClInclude Include="..\..\..\..\source\component\fs\driver\romfs\vsf_romfs.h" />
<ClInclude Include="..\..\..\..\source\hal\driver\common\adc\adc_interface.h" />
<ClInclude Include="..\..\..\..\source\hal\driver\common\adc\adc_template.h" />
Expand Down Expand Up @@ -767,6 +778,13 @@
<ClInclude Include="..\..\demo\tgui_demo\tgui_demo\tgui_designer\tgui_designer_common.h" />
</ItemGroup>
<ItemGroup>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_reader.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_trace.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_aead.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_cipher.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_hash.c" />
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_mac.c" />
<ClCompile Include="..\..\..\..\source\component\fs\driver\romfs\vsf_romfs.c" />
<ClCompile Include="..\..\..\..\source\hal\driver\common\adc\adc_interface.c" />
<ClCompile Include="..\..\..\..\source\hal\driver\common\dac\dac_common.c" />
Expand Down
54 changes: 54 additions & 0 deletions example/template/project/vc/vsf_template_win.vcxproj.filters
Original file line number Diff line number Diff line change
Expand Up @@ -3444,6 +3444,39 @@
<ClInclude Include="..\..\..\..\source\component\fs\driver\romfs\vsf_romfs.h">
<Filter>vsf\component\fs\driver\romfs</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time_internal.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time_invasive.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\ecp_invasive.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_common.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_error.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_reader.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_trace.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_aead.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_cipher.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_hash.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
<ClInclude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_mac.h">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ClInclude>
</ItemGroup>
<ItemGroup>
<ClCompile Include="..\..\..\..\source\utilities\template\vsf_bitmap.c">
Expand Down Expand Up @@ -5984,6 +6017,27 @@
<ClCompile Include="..\..\..\..\source\component\fs\driver\romfs\vsf_romfs.c">
<Filter>vsf\component\fs\driver\romfs</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\constant_time.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_reader.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\mps_trace.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_aead.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_cipher.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_hash.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
<ClCompile Include="..\..\..\..\source\component\3rd-party\mbedtls\raw\library\psa_crypto_mac.c">
<Filter>vsf\component\3rd-party\mbedtls\raw\library</Filter>
</ClCompile>
</ItemGroup>
<ItemGroup>
<None Include="..\..\..\..\source\hal\arch\common\arch_without_thread_suspend\vsf_arch_without_thread_suspend_template.inc">
Expand Down

0 comments on commit c601313

Please sign in to comment.